Compare all specifications:
2009 Ford Flex | 2005 Suzuki Liana | |
Make | Ford | Suzuki |
Model | Flex | Liana |
Year Released | 2009 | 2005 |
Body Type | Crossover |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 3496 cc | 1586 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 256 HP | 104 HP |
Torque | 245 Nm | 144 Nm |
Drive Type | Front | 4WD |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 7 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Width | 1930 mm | 1700 mm |
